Chemical Composition of Soy Wax

Soy wax, a compound acquired from soybean oil, contains an intricate blend of chemical compounds that add to its distinct properties for candle light making. The primary elements of soy wax are fatty acids, with linoleic, oleic, palmitic, stearic, and linolenic acids being the most plentiful. These fats are in charge of soy wax's low melting point, which enables a longer-lasting and cleaner melt compared to traditional paraffin candles. Additionally, soy wax has triglycerides, which are esters formed from glycerol and 3 fat molecules. This structure offers soy wax its renewable and naturally degradable attributes, making it an eco-friendly choice to paraffin wax. In addition, soy wax can be combined with various other necessary oils or all-natural waxes to improve its scent toss and total efficiency. Comprehending the chemical structure of soy wax is vital for candle light manufacturers seeking to create top quality, lasting products that interest eco aware customers.




Burning Process in Soy Candles





The chemical composition of soy wax straight influences the combustion procedure in soy candles, impacting factors such as melt time, aroma release, and environmental impact. When a soy candle is lit, the warmth from the fire melts the wax near the wick.




The combustion effectiveness of soy candles is influenced by the purity of the soy wax and the quality of the wick. A clean-burning soy candle light with a correctly sized wick will produce a steady fire and minimize soot formation. This not only prolongs the shed time of the candle yet likewise boosts the launch of scents. In addition, soy wax candles have a reduced ecological impact compared to paraffin candles because of their eco-friendly and eco-friendly nature.

Ecological Advantages of Soy Wax





Thought about a lasting option to standard paraffin wax, soy wax provides significant environmental advantages that make it a preferred choice among eco-conscious consumers. One significant advantage of soy wax is its sustainable sourcing. Soy wax is originated from soybean oil, which is primarily grown in the United States. The growing of soybeans helps support local farmers and lowers the dependence on non-renewable fossil fuels made use of in paraffin wax manufacturing. In addition, soy wax is naturally degradable, suggesting it damages down naturally without releasing damaging toxins into the atmosphere. This particular makes soy wax candle lights a much more eco-friendly choice contrasted to paraffin wax candle lights, which are made from oil, a non-renewable resource. Soy wax burns cleaner and creates much less soot than paraffin wax, adding to much better interior air quality and reducing the requirement for cleaning and upkeep. Overall, the ecological advantages of soy wax line up with the expanding demand for eco-friendly and lasting products in the marketplace.
